Show 00 IP IMS H MElfilTOlffl Want First Opportunity to Buy Houses Erected by Government Govern-ment During War WASHINGTON, Fob 11. Recommendations Recom-mendations that an experienced workman' work-man' be appointed to the next vacancy on the shipping board and that shipyard ship-yard employes be given first opportunity opportun-ity to purchase houses erected by the government during the war were made in a memorial sent to President Wilson Wil-son today by the national conference of American ship workers in session here. Inclusion of a man from their ranks on the shipping board, the memorial mem-orial paid, would Insure loyal co-operation of yard workers. The conference also drew up a memorial for presentation to congress urging immediato action to prevent the nation's merchant marine reverting revert-ing to its pre-war status. Such action the memorial declares, should include adoption of a definite shipbuilding program pro-gram government operation of the fleet until it Is capable of competing with foreign lines, construction of fast passenger and mail ships, recognition of workmen by inclusion on every board appointed for construction or operation, and maintenance of " the American navy in a position "commensurate "commen-surate with the standing or the United Slates as a nation." |
